A Postgraduate Certificate in Pediatric Telemedicine specializing in Pediatric Teleurology provides comprehensive training in the application of telehealth technologies within pediatric urology. This program equips professionals with the skills to deliver high-quality, remote healthcare services to young patients.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ering the technical aspects of pediatric telemedicine platforms, developing proficiency in remote patient assessment and diagnosis, and understanding the ethical and legal considerations surrounding the use of teleurology. Participants will also gain experience in effective communication and collaboration with remote care teams.
The duration of such a certificate program varies, usually ranging from several months to a year, depending on the program's intensity and credit requirements. The program structure may involve online modules, practical workshops, and potentially clinical placements.
